免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

没有签名的apk怎么安装

在Android系统中,APK文件是一种用于安装和分发应用程序的文件格式。在正常情况下,APK文件需要进行签名才能在设备上安装和运行。然而,有时我们可能需要安装一个没有签名的APK文件,比如在开发过程中进行调试或测试。下面将详细介绍没有签名的APK文件如何安装,包括原理和具体步骤。

首先,我们来了解一下APK签名的原理。在Android系统中,APK签名是为了保证应用程序的安全性和完整性而引入的机制。签名文件包含了一个数字证书和应用程序的摘要信息,签名后的APK文件将与签名文件进行验证,确保APK文件未被篡改和恶意修改。在正式发布应用程序时,应该使用一个由可信证书机构(CA)颁发的数字证书进行签名。

然而,在开发和测试阶段,我们可能需要安装没有签名的APK文件,这些文件可能是由开发者直接导出的,没有经过数字证书的签名。这样的APK文件在安装之前需要先进行一些特殊的配置,下面是具体的步骤:

1. 在Android设备上打开“设置”应用,找到并点击“安全”或“隐私”选项。

2. 找到“未知来源”选项,并启用它。这个选项允许安装来自未知来源的应用程序。在不同的Android版本中,该选项可能会有所不同的名称或位置。

3. 将没有签名的APK文件复制到Android设备上。可以使用USB数据线连接设备和电脑,然后直接将APK文件拷贝到设备的存储空间中,如内置存储或SD卡。

4. 在Android设备上打开文件管理器应用,找到并点击刚刚复制的APK文件。

5. 系统将提示你是否要安装这个没有签名的应用,点击“安装”按钮。

6. 安装完成后,你可以在设备的应用列表或桌面上找到已经安装的应用程序图标。

需要注意的是,安装没有签名的APK文件存在一定的风险,因为这些文件未经过数字证书的验证,可能容易被篡改或携带恶意代码。因此,在正式发布应用程序前,务必使用可信证书机构颁发的数字证书对APK文件进行签名。

总结起来,安装没有签名的APK文件需要先在设备的安全设置中启用“未知来源”选项,然后将APK文件复制到设备上并使用文件管理器安装。虽然这样做有一定的风险,但在开发和测试阶段是必要的。在正式发布应用程序前,应该使用数字证书对APK文件进行签名,以确保应用程序的安全性和完整性。


相关知识:
ipa上传至appstoreconnect
IPA上传至App Store Connect:开发者必备指南 在移动应用开发的世界中,将应用成功发布到App Store是每个开发者的终极目标。然而,这个过程并不总是那么简单,尤其是对于新手开发者来说。其中,将IPA文件上传至App Store Conn
2025-05-06
苹果ios签名开发源码怎么用
苹果iOS签名开发源码是一种用于进行iOS应用程序签名的工具或库。签名可以确保应用程序的安全性和可靠性,防止未授权的修改和篡改。iOS应用程序签名是将应用程序与开发者的私钥相关联,并将签名信息嵌入应用程序包中。设备会在安装应用程序时验证签名,以确保应用程序
2023-07-20
ios免签名什么意思
iOS免签名是指在iOS设备上安装未经苹果官方签名的应用程序,即不需要通过苹果开发者账号进行签名和安装的方式。免签名可以让用户在不越狱的情况下,直接安装第三方应用,提供了更多的自由度和选择性。iOS应用程序一般需要经过苹果的审核和签名才能在设备上正常运行。
2023-07-18
有什么好的日语签名翻译软件吗安卓
在安卓平台上,有一款非常出色的日语签名翻译软件叫做"Japanese Signature Translation"(日语签名翻译)。这款应用程序专门为想要在社交媒体、聊天应用和个人资料中使用日语签名的用户提供了便利。该应用程序的安装非常简单,只需从Goog
2023-07-17
去除安卓签名检验
标题:去除安卓签名检验详解:原理、方法和注意事项引言:在Android开发和应用逆向的过程中,签名验证是常见的一种安全机制。但是,有时候我们需要去除签名检验,比如为了对应用进行逆向分析或修改,或者为了应用自动化测试等目的。本文将详细介绍去除安卓签名检验的原
2023-07-17
apk如何添加证书
在android应用开发中,为应用程序添加证书是非常重要的。通过添加证书,可以确保应用的安全性和可靠性。证书用于对应用进行签名,以验证应用的身份和完整性。本文将介绍如何在apk中添加证书。首先,我们需要了解证书的原理。Android应用使用的签名证书是X.
2023-07-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4